African jazz trumpeter, Paul Lunga, made history in July with a debut performance at the Cultural Centre.
On Sunday, July 20th, Montserrat’s new town centre in Little Bay hosted the debut performance.
In his homeland, Zimbabwe, Lunga is known as the undisputed “king of jazz horns”.

In Montserrat, Sunday, July 13th, marked the start of this year’s annual Calabash Festival.
The Third Annual Calabash Festival includes a week of activities featuring a variety of exciting recreational and cultural events.

The Government of Montserrat says that it recently received two forty-foot containers of medical equipment from the Government of Gibraltar.
The Government Information Unit (GIU) says, “A technical staff is currently examining the equipment, and the Government of Gibraltar will provide technical assistance for set up of the specialized equipment in due course.”
